Deploying advanced mechanical structures to protect high-value optical assets in harsh security environments.
Borderlines and coastal perimeters are subject to wind forces, airborne salt crusting, and extreme temperature swings. A dual cabin design allows for the independent separation of long-range daytime optical zooms (using high-transparency optical glass) and thermal infrared cores (utilizing specialized Germanium window elements).
This layout ensures thermal cross-talk is kept to a minimum, and keeps internal moisture under control through IP67 sealed chambers filled with dry nitrogen.
Early fire detection relies on high-resolution continuous thermal scanning alongside optical validation. By using dual-window camera housings mounted on heavy-duty worm-gear positioning systems, sensors can operate continuously in high-temperature, smoke-laden conditions.
Specialized window coatings shield interior sensors from intense heat radiation, preserving high MTBF (Mean Time Between Failures) metrics for long-term deployments.
Nuclear facilities, electrical grids, and petrochemical hubs require 24/7 dual-sensor monitoring. Advanced anti-corrosive treatments, like our C5-M marine-grade paint coatings, protect housings from chemical exposures and atmospheric degradation, ensuring reliable performance in harsh environments.

The BIT-PT510 is a compact pan tilt unit with a top load capacity of 10kg/22lb, powered by a high-precision stepper motor and worm/gear drive. The unit features 360° pan rotation and ±60° tilt rotation with speeds up to 30°/S. It is designed to support camera housings, spotlights, and loudspeakers in video surveillance, border and coastal defense, and forest fire prevention systems.
Our smallest pan tilt unit, weighing only 3.5kg. It supports payloads up to 3.5kg/7.7lb, making it ideal for deployments where size and weight are critical constraints.
Capable of rotation speeds up to 100°/second, this unit enables rapid positioning and tracking. It combines high-speed operation with a worm-gear tilt drive for a 10kg payload and an angular range of -90° to +40°.

Our long-term R&D vision for multi-spectral protective housings focuses on addressing emerging intelligence and environmental challenges.
We are integrating micro-controller networks inside our dual cabins to collect data on temperature, humidity, pressure, and window transmissive degradation. These sensors dynamically adjust internal heating arrays, air circulation fans, and automated glass cleaners to maintain ideal imaging conditions while reducing overall power usage.
Future development phases involve deploying lighter, high-performance alloys and carbon fiber structures alongside marine-grade stainless steels. This helps lower overall system weight, reduce mechanical inertia on pan-tilt heads, and improve resistance to corrosive chemicals and seaside air.
As long-range thermal cores and ultra-telephoto optical systems continue to shrink, alignment tolerances become more critical. We are introducing sub-millimeter factory alignment procedures and adjustable internal mounting plates to simplify calibration and ensure the optical axes of both sensors remain parallel across long distances.
